As you try to construct a more convincing answer, you're beginning to present
a philosophy of art.  In the philosophies that Kivy has been discussing, the
issues of representation and content are very important.  I suppose that you
could choose to ignore them -- but then, what issues will you raise to
distinguish the worthy from the unworthy?

By way of an aesthetic experiment, I have just dumped my bowl of delicious
strawberries and oatmeal onto the carpet.

And so I have accomplished something which can be said to have design,
meaning, and uniqueness.

But how worthy was either the goal or the accomplishment?
